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 3/4 cup water
  • 1/2 cup liquid glucose (light corn syrup)
  • Few drops black gel food coloring
  • 6 Granny Smith apples (or 12 small apples)

Instructions

  1. Prepare your workspace by greasing baking paper on a tray.
  2. Insert bamboo skewers into each apple.
  3. In a saucepan, combine sugar, water, corn syrup, and food coloring over medium heat until sugar dissolves.
  4. Continue cooking until reaching hard crack stage (150ºC/310ºF).
  5. Dip each apple into the hot caramel, ensuring an even coat.
  6. Place on the prepared tray and allow to cool completely before serving.
